A rectangular prism has a length of 3 feet, a height of 7 feet, and a width of 14 feet. What is its volume, in cubic feet?

Answer:

V = 294ft^3

Step-by-step explanation:

If volume is length times width then times hight, then we can conclude this eqation:

LxWxH=V

We can them put values for L,W, and H to make this eqation:

3x14x7=V

We can then do the calculationsto get

V = 294ft

If we are measuring in cubic feet we add ^3, so our final eqation will be

3x14x7= 294ft^3
